This Project Report outlines the comprehensive strategy for deploying the advanced digital judicial infrastructure, referred to herein as Judge, within the federal court system of Iraq Baghdad. The primary objective of this initiative is to modernize case management, enhance transparency, reduce backlog congestion, and ensure adherence to international standards of justice. As Iraq Baghdad serves as the political and administrative heart of the nation, implementing robust judicial technology here sets a critical precedent for the entire country. This document details the scope, objectives, methodology, risk assessment associated with deploying Judge, and the expected outcomes for legal stakeholders in Iraq Baghdad.
The judicial system in Iraq Baghdad has historically faced significant challenges, including manual record-keeping, lengthy processing times, and limited accessibility for litigants. The centralization of major legal matters in the capital city means that any inefficiency here has a cascading effect on the national economy and social stability. The introduction of Judge, a specialized Case Management System (CMS) designed for high-volume jurisdictions, aims to address these systemic bottlenecks.
The project is aligned with the broader digital transformation goals of the Iraqi Ministry of Justice. By focusing first on Iraq Baghdad, where court density is highest, we can refine the Judge platform’s capabilities before scaling to regional governorates. The term "Judge" in this context refers not only to the software platform but also to the paradigm shift toward data-driven decision-making and automated procedural compliance.
